THE ASSOCIATION FOR DRESSINGS AND SAUCES CELEBRATES NATIONAL SALAD WEEK: JULY 25 - 31

(July 2006) ATLANTA, GA – “Let your creativity flow and discover endless salad possibilities during National Salad Week,” says The Association for Dressings and Sauces (ADS). The Atlanta-based trade association of salad dressing and sauce manufacturers and suppliers to the industry prides itself on revealing the many health benefits that salads with dressings provide.

Whether as a snack or a main entrée, there is a wealth of health benefits you can look forward to when incorporating salads into your daily menu. Salads with dressing offer numerous health benefits and are a staple for anyone committed to eating healthy and maintaining a nutritionally-balanced life. Many standard salad components are an excellent source of fiber, which has been linked to a reduced risk of cancer. In addition, salad dressings provide an essential fatty acid called alpha-linolenic acid that helps protect women against fatal heart attacks, as well as the Vitamin E our bodies need to maintain an optimal immune system. Here’s another benefit – salad dressings are and have always been trans fat free.

“Salads and salad dressings are so much a part of the meal routine that many people have forgotten the integral role they play in a balanced diet,” according to Jeannie Milewski, ADS’ Executive Director. “Not only are they delicious and easy to prepare, they are also loaded with important vitamins and nutrients.”
